Joseph DROUIN was born 27 September 1811 in Québec, Lower Canada

Joseph DROUIN was the child of Joseph DROUIN   and   Marguerite TREMBLAY and the grandchild of: (paternal)  Joseph-Felix DROUIN and Marie-Anne PARE (maternal)  Michel TREMBLAY and Abondance DEBLOIS

Joseph DROUIN died 1 August 1834 in Québec, Lower Canada .





m. 22 NOV 1831 • St-Roch-de-Québec, Québec
Marie-Julie Marcoux
(1807–)

Occupation

Joseph DROUIN was a charpentier.
In New France, the occupation of charpentier, or carpenter, covered all trades of wood construction.

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
